Q: Is 2,112,950 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,112,950 is a composite number.

Why is 2,112,950 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,112,950 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 7 10 14 25 35 50 70 175 350 6,037 12,074 30,185 42,259 60,370 84,518 150,925 211,295 301,850 422,590 1,056,475 and 2,112,950, with no remainder.

Since 2,112,950 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,112,950, it is a composite number.
